Readymade books for APFC exam
- Exams like APFC are not taken at regular interval, so whenever such exam comes, some bogus moneyminded publication houses, just copy paste few paragraphs and pages related to the syllabus topics, from other books and publish a Guidebook for APFC exam, containing 300 pages!
- After 1 month, These people will just change the book cover release the same content for Sales Tax inspector’s exam! Therefore such bogus quality readymade books or study material does not serve much purpose.
- Reason: Many candidates also prepare simultaneously for UPSC, State PSC, Banks, SSC and similar jobs therefore competitive level is always very high. You need to have your basic concepts clear and foundations strong. Don’t try to look for shortcuts using such readymade books. (Same Advice for RBI officer, LIC AAO and other similar exams.)
Cost Factor
The General Studies Manual (TMH, Unique, Spectrum) are quite expensive. They’re written for UPSC exam hence very thick and heavy. But the entire manual is not relevant for APFC exam, you’ve to do selective study of only a few topics. So better just borrow it from some friend or try to get an old copy.

There are only two rules to crack this exam
- For Non-aptitude (history, polity etc) Revise – revise – revise
- For aptitude (math,logical reasoning) practice- practice-practice.

For APFC English portion, You’ve to prepare: sentence correction, meaning of idioms, synonyms and antonyms, Fill in the blanks etc.(+ reading comprehension if given.)
If you’ve any IBPS manual, you’ll find these topics included in it, otherwise you can always use google- there are plenty of free articles for these topics.
